Abstract:
The protein long interspersed nuclear elements-1 (LINE-1) serves as a useful surrogate marker of global methylation but little is known for Merkel cell carcinoma. LINE-1 expression was found only in Merkel cell polyomavirus (MCPyV)-positive Merkel cell carcinomas but not in MCPyV-negative Merkel cell carcinomas, suggesting that epigenetic dysregulation may be associated with MCPyV expression.

Non-LTR Retrotransposons
11.9K
As the name suggests, non-LTR retrotransposons lack the long terminal repeats characteristic of the LTR retrotransposons. Additionally, both LTR and non-LTR retrotransposons use distinct mechanisms of mobilization. Non-LTR retrotransposons are further divided into two classes - Long interspersed nuclear elements (LINEs) and short interspersed nuclear elements (SINEs), both of which occur abundantly in most mammals, including humans.
